I Background

In recent years, in response to global warming and climate change caused by greenhouse gas emissions,many countries have focused on promoting electric vehicles to replace traditional fuel vehicles. And the construction of charging piles is very important in the promotion of new energy vehicles.Therefore, a large number of charging pile projects have emerged around the world.

II Project Overview

A Japanese charging pile manufacturer plans to use our company's DC power meters to match the company's DC charging piles. Because the Japanese market pays more attention to isolation safety, the customer choose hall sensor to connect to the DC meter rather than shunt solution,
